DUSHANBE, July 20, 2026 (NIAT Khovar) – The Days of Tajik Culture will open in Mongolia on Sunday, highlighting efforts to strengthen cultural ties and people-to-people exchanges between the two countries.

The program will feature an exhibition of paintings and photographs showcasing Tajikistan’s history, cultural heritage, traditions, achievements since independence and natural landscapes, followed by a gala concert by Tajik artists.

As part of the event, Tajik Minister of Culture Matlubakhon Sattoriyon met with Mongolia’s Minister of Culture, Sports, Tourism and Youth, Aldarjavkhlan Jukov, to discuss expanding cooperation in culture and the arts. The ministers expressed interest in promoting partnerships between educational institutions, training cultural professionals and exchanging expertise.

Tajikistan and Mongolia established diplomatic relations on April 24, 1992. In recent years, bilateral cooperation has expanded across political, economic and cultural fields, supported by shared interests and longstanding historical and cultural connections.
